The Nuisance Inspection Division, under the auspices of the Housing & Community Development Dept. performs all appropriate functions regarding the investigation, identification and verification of unsafe, unseemly and unsightly conditions which, if left unchecked, could threaten the public health and well-being. The purpose of this ordinance is to insure that:

  • Properties are properly maintained
  • Propertyowners, landlords and tenants comply with all City Codes
  • Protect the lives, health and property of all City residents.

Some Typical Complaints | top of page

You may call the Nuisance Inspection Division M–F 9am–5pm TEL: 609-386-0200, ext. 149 to confidentially report instances of:

  • unapproved or illegal apartments
  • yards or properties in disrepair
  • boarded up buildings
  • overgrown or weed lots
  • persistent bad odors
  • presence of vagrants or squatters
  • rats or other vermin or pests
  • or other annoyances

Callers will remain anonymous.

Landlord Registration Program | top of page

All Landlords in the City of Burlington are required by this program to obtain a license to operate residential rental unit(s). This involves completing a registration form and paying the appropriate fees. The Municipal Clerk’s office will receipt the fees, file the registration forms and notify our office of the application. Our office will schedule and complete the required inspections and issue the licenses and Certificate of Occupancy.
